Chapter: Musnad ʿUmārah ibn Ruwaybah al-Thaqafī (may Allah be pleased with him)
(26)
مُسْنَدُ عُمَارَةَ بْنِ رُوَيْبَةَ الثَّقَفِيِّ رَضِيَ اللَّهُ عَنْهُ
Three-Narrator Ahadith 269
ʿUmārah ibn Ruwaybah al-Thaqafī (may Allah be pleased with him) reported:
I heard the Messenger of Allah ﷺ say, “No one who prays before sunrise and before sunset will ever enter the Fire.”
Reference:
Musnad Aḥmad 269
حَدَّثَنَا سُفْيَانُ بْنُ عُيَيْنَةَ، عَنْ عَبْدِ الْمَلِكِ بْنِ عُمَيْرٍ، عَنْ عِمَارَةَ بْنِ رُوَيْبَةَ: سَمِعْتُ رَسُولَ اللَّهِ ﷺ يَقُولُ: «لَنْ يَلِجَ النَّارَ أَحَدٌ صَلَّى قَبْلَ طُلُوعِ الشَّمْسِ وَقَبْلَ غُرُوبِهَا
| Grade: | Ṣaḥīḥ |
its transmitters trustworthy.
Chain: Sufyān ibn ʿUyaynah → ʿAbd al-Malik ibn ʿUmayr → ʿUmārah ibn Ruwaybah al-Thaqafī (may Allah be pleased with him). Rijāl: (1) Sufyān: Sufyān ibn ʿUyaynah ibn Mīmūn al-Hilālī al-Kūfī (d. 198 AH); thiqah ḥāfiẓ faqīh imām. (2) ʿAbd al-Malik ibn ʿUmayr: ʿAbd al-Malik ibn ʿUmayr al-Lakhmī al-Kūfī (d. 136 AH), thiqah, here specifically confirmed by Sufyān himself, who when asked from whom ʿAbd al-Malik had heard this, answered plainly, "from ʿUmārah ibn Ruwaybah", again illustrating the transmitters' meticulous concern for precision of source. (3) ʿUmārah ibn Ruwaybah al-Thaqafī: a Companion who later settled in Kūfah. Takhrīj: Muslim (634); al-Tirmidhī (2637); al-Nasāʾī (487). Commentary: "Before sunrise and before sunset" refers to the Fajr and ʿAṣr prayers, understood by the commentators as representative of the entire prescribed prayers, since diligence in preserving these two, often the most difficult to maintain, being at the edges of sleep and daily activity, reflects genuine steadfastness in prayer as a whole, a promise of salvation from the Fire for whoever guards them.
